Data breaches remain a consistent threat to organizations and their sensitive databases. Protecting data goes beyond just restricting access; understanding what data you have and how it should be handled is critical. This is where database data masking discovery becomes essential. It helps identify sensitive data across your systems and ensures that your masking efforts are applied effectively.
Let’s dive into what database data masking discovery is, why it’s important, and how you can implement it seamlessly in your workflow to boost security.
What is Database Data Masking Discovery?
Database data masking discovery is the process of locating sensitive or confidential data across your database. It builds an inventory of the data types and locations to ensure critical information like Personally Identifiable Information (PII), financial records, or intellectual property is identified before it can be masked for protection.
Instead of applying masking blindly across your database, this discovery phase finds where masking is needed. It’s an important step to prevent exposing sensitive information while maintaining the usability of your databases for testing, development, or analytics.
Why Database Data Masking Discovery Matters
When dealing with databases, not every piece of information requires the same level of security. Some data may be non-sensitive, while other data may need strict access controls or obfuscation measures. Without discovery, you risk applying security inconsistently or missing critical vulnerabilities. Here’s why you should prioritize it:
1. Identify Your Risk Zones
You can’t protect what you don’t know exists. Sensitive information scattered across various databases is the prime target for malicious threats. Discovery highlights where your risky or regulated data resides.
2. Stay Compliance Ready
Regulatory requirements like GDPR, CCPA, and HIPAA often mandate only specific data to be masked or encrypted. Knowing your sensitive data ensures you meet compliance criteria effectively.
3. Reduce Overhead Costs
Masking entire databases without discovery adds unnecessary processing overhead. By focusing on only the sensitive segments of the data, you save resources and improve performance.
4. Support Secure Lifecycle Management
Whether you're using databases in production or passing them to development teams for testing, discovery ensures critical data remains masked so it doesn’t accidentally leak into less secure environments.
To maximize the benefits of database data masking discovery, follow these steps:
Step 1: Scan Your Databases
Use automated tools to scan and analyze both structured and unstructured data stored in your systems. These tools can detect patterns indicative of PII, financial records, or regulatory-sensitive data.
Step 2: Classify Data Based on Sensitivity
Once identified, categorize the data based on its sensitivity level. For example:
- Public: Non-sensitive, available for open-use.
- Internal Use: Confidential, but not requiring masking.
- Restricted: High-sensitivity data requiring urgent masking.
Step 3: Map Data Relationships
Identify how sensitive data flows between databases, applications, and users. This mapping helps ensure that masked data stays secure throughout its lifecycle.
Finally, integrate the discovery process with data masking tools to implement obfuscation policies. This ensures only authorized groups can see the original data while others interact with masked values.
Challenges in Database Data Masking Discovery
While the process is essential, several challenges can arise during data masking discovery:
- Scalability: Managing discovery across large or globally distributed databases requires robust tooling.
- False Positives: Tools may mislabel non-sensitive data as regulated data, creating unnecessary masking efforts.
- Legacy Systems: Older systems may lack standard structures, making discovery and classification harder.
- Consistency: Without automation, ensuring consistent discovery and masking across all environments might demand high manual effort.
To overcome these challenges, adopt systems that prioritize automation and integration.
Database Data Masking Discovery Made Simple
Implementing an effective discovery process doesn’t need to be painful or time-consuming. With the right solutions, sensitive data can be identified, classified, and protected seamlessly—reducing security risks and keeping you audit-compliant.
Hoop.dev simplifies the entire workflow. Its data discovery tools allow you to locate sensitive data across your databases and apply masking policies automatically. You can see this in action and have it running in minutes.
Start securing your sensitive information effortlessly today. Explore how Hoop.dev can enhance your database data masking discovery process.